The Subtle Map of Deeper Healing—somatic attunement, body intelligence & the quiet architecture of transformation.

We often start our healing with the obvious: trauma, diet, therapy, big shifts. But once those large patterns move, the work grows quieter and more precise. The next frontier is small — sensation, subtle constriction, the hidden places where story and tissue meet. These margins are where true refinement and lasting change live.

In this solo episode, Ayla shares a practical, embodied approach to that subtle work: how to return to the body not only as a starting point, but as a refined instrument for mapping what’s left. She weaves personal examples (chronic digestive pain, anxiety, the partial remission of a food sensitivity) with invitations to guided, hypnosis-adjacent practices that help you name sensations, trace mental stories inside the body, and build durable self-trust. What begins as something that “doesn’t make sense” to the mind becomes a reliable inner map for safety, regulation, and ease.
